  4. Jun 28, 2024 · "The Jazz Singer" (1927), directed by Alan Crosland, stars Al Jolson and is significant for being the first feature-length film with synchronised dialogue and songs. This film marked the beginning of the end for the silent film era and showcased the potential of sound in cinema, changing the industry forever.
